They’re quick. 0-60 in 6.2s, which is nothing to snuff at.

ETA: I believe C&D said the Aura XR is a great daily driver, with the only complaint being light center-steering and a soft ride. They did say it was the most serene/quiet car since the Rolls they tested the same year.

The Vectra C, an also-ran in the midsize field. It doesn’t shine anywhere. The Ford Mondeo (Fusion) offered better handling, the Passat felt more upmarket, the Skoda Octavia was priced more competitively... and so on. They didn’t have any obvious flaws, and as they age there isn’t anything catastrophic to watch out for, as Opel learnt a lesson and upped their game.

But, that’s only the mediocre Vectra. I have no idea what they did to it to “Americanize” it. So far, no car has come out the other end of that process and it was better than before.

The v6 is pretty quick. It’s a decent cruiser. The cabin is quiet and the chassis is forgiving in rough stuff but fairly sporting for a front driver. An XR is equipped with pretty much everything GM had back in the day. There’s a batch of these that has a wonky version of Bluetooth that can pair a phone, but won’t stream audio. I don’t recall when the changeover happened.

The epsilon platform was sort of the beginning of GM getting their shit together in market segments besides full size trucks and corvette. This would be a decent buy.
